According to the public record, 5, Balfour Road, Gloucester is a period freehold house with 839 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 169 m2 plot.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 3 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 5, Balfour Road, Gloucester is £214,821 and the estimated rental value is £1,359 per month.

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 5, Balfour Road, Gloucester is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£225,562 and a rental value of £1,427 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£199,783 and a rental value of £1,264 per month.

5, Balfour Road, Gloucester has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of E.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 26 Aug 2020.
The property is connected to mains gas and has partial double glazing.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
According to HM Land Registry, 5, Balfour Road, Gloucester was last sold on 18th February 2021 for £162,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has only had this single sale since 1995.
